====Usage notes====
 
'''''Sieg Heil''''' became the salute of the German National Socialist (Nazi) party in the 1920s. It developed to the so called {{w|Hitler salute}}, the use of which was later made obligatory to all Germans in the [[Third Reich]]. After [[WWII]], the public use of any form of the Hitler salute was criminalized in Germany and Austria. In Germany it is punishable with up to three years in prison.
